The term pseudo originates from the Greek pseudes, meaning "lying" or "false," and functions as a prefix denoting false imitation or spurious authenticity. In contemporary usage, pseudo describes entities that mimic genuine systems, products, or concepts while lacking legitimate foundation or verified evidence. Unlike simple mistakes or misunderstandings, pseudo involves intentional design to mislead, often exploiting gaps in knowledge, regulatory oversight, or public trust.
Consider the proliferation of pseudo-scientific health products that borrow terminology from legitimate medicine without adhering to clinical standards. These items often feature impressive-sounding jargon, cherry-picked testimonials, and superficial references to complex theories like quantum physics. The goal is not education but persuasion, steering vulnerable individuals toward purchases that offer no real benefit and may even cause harm.
Technology has become a primary amplifier of pseudo, lowering the barriers to creating and distributing convincing fakes. Advanced imaging software, voice synthesis, and generative artificial intelligence enable perpetrators to produce fraudulent documents, realistic deepfakes, and counterfeit digital identities with unprecedented ease. Meanwhile, social media algorithms prioritize engagement over accuracy, allowing pseudo narratives to reach vast audiences before fact-checkers can respond.
Economically, pseudo generates massive illicit revenues by exploiting consumer desires for quick fixes, luxury goods, or exclusive access. Counterfeit fashion items, pirated software, and fake academic credentials undermine legitimate businesses and devalue authentic achievement. Regulators face significant challenges in tracking these activities across borders, particularly when perpetrators operate in jurisdictions with weak enforcement or where penalties are minimal.
Pseudo environments also thrive in information ecosystems where confirmation bias and ideological polarization take hold. In such spaces, individuals seek out narratives that reinforce existing beliefs, making them more receptive to misleading explanations wrapped in familiar rhetoric. Complex issues are reduced to simplistic slogans, and contradictory evidence is dismissed as part of a supposed conspiracy, further entrenching pseudo frameworks.
The following sections outline key mechanisms through which pseudo operates, providing concrete examples and explaining why each element contributes to its persistence and appeal.
- Manufactured Authority: Individuals or entities adopt titles, uniforms, or certifications that imply expertise without undergoing legitimate verification or training. For example, a person might claim to be a "quantum wellness coach" using invented terminology to sell unproven treatments.
- Technical Jargon Abuse: Specialized language from fields such as physics, medicine, or computer science is deployed incorrectly to create an illusion of depth. Laypeople may feel impressed by the vocabulary yet unable to scrutinize the underlying claims critically.
- Visual Deception: Logos, websites, and packaging are meticulously designed to mirror those of established institutions, exploiting the brain's tendency to associate familiar visuals with trust and safety.
- Selective Evidence Presentation: Only data supporting a predetermined conclusion is highlighted, while contradictory studies or methodological flaws are omitted entirely. This curated evidence can resemble legitimate research at a glance.
- Social Proof Manipulation: Fake reviews, bot-generated testimonials, and fabricated follower counts create the impression of widespread acceptance and popularity, reducing skepticism among new audiences.
These tactics are not mutually exclusive and are frequently combined in sophisticated campaigns targeting specific sectors such as finance, education, and healthcare. The cumulative effect is a blurring of lines between legitimate information and carefully crafted illusion.
Educational institutions increasingly report encounters with pseudo in student work, where essays are assembled from fabricated sources and generated text. Academics face pressures to publish constantly, sometimes tempted by predatory journals that promise quick acceptance in exchange for fees. These outlets exist primarily to lend an air of credibility to pseudo research, using impressive-sounding names while bypassing rigorous peer review.
Health and wellness represent another high-impact domain where pseudo can cause direct physical harm. Treatments promoted as "natural" or "holistic" may discourage patients from seeking evidence-based medical care, leading to worsened conditions or preventable fatalities. Regulatory agencies struggle to keep pace with novel marketing strategies that rebrand old substances with trendy scientific labels.
In the financial sector, pseudo investment schemes promise extraordinary returns with minimal risk, often leveraging cryptocurrency and blockchain terminology to appear innovative. Historical patterns show repeated cycles of such scams, yet new variants continually emerge, suggesting that regulatory frameworks and investor education have not advanced sufficiently.
Recognizing pseudo requires cultivating specific habits of inquiry, such as checking the provenance of information, verifying credentials through independent databases, and consulting multiple reputable sources before forming conclusions. Critical thinking education should emphasize not only logical reasoning but also emotional regulation, since fear, hope, and anger can override careful analysis. Media literacy programs must adapt continuously to address new formats and technologies, ensuring that audiences can navigate an increasingly synthetic media landscape.
Organizations combatting pseudo face difficult choices between rapid takedowns of false content and adherence to due process that respects privacy and avoids censorship accusations. Transparency about methods and criteria used to identify and label pseudo claims can build public trust, even when the process is imperfect. Collaboration between technologists, journalists, legal experts, and community leaders is crucial for developing sustainable strategies that do not inadvertently suppress legitimate dissent or innovation.
The long-term impact of pseudo extends beyond immediate financial losses or health risks, potentially eroding the shared factual foundation necessary for democratic decision-making. When citizens cannot agree on basic realities, constructive dialogue becomes nearly impossible, replaced by entrenched factions speaking past one another. Addressing this threat demands sustained commitment from educators, journalists, technologists, and policymakers invested in restoring and maintaining epistemic integrity across society.
